Eng sync item: sig check failing on shared lib @corewick/components. Cause: v3.7.0 published under the rotated key, but CI verifiers on the Dunmere runners still pin the old one. Versioning policy unchanged — minors get re-signed, patches don't. Fix: bump the trust config, rebuild, done. Affected teams should update before Thursday's freeze. For convenience, the current signing key used for v3.7.0 and later is below.

rollout seal: bky9_PeXH1fTLY

Release checklist — TideGlance widget v4.2. Confirm the tide-table widget renders correctly for the Port Marrow and Gullhaven test stations, including the half-hour interpolation fix shipped this cycle. Support should verify that stale cache warnings no longer appear after a station switch, and that the offline banner clears within ten seconds of reconnect. If a customer reports mismatched tide heights, collect their station code before escalating. The verified build token for this release appears below.

session token of tajef-bageg = htk21_5d90d574934f3ccae6437

## Escalation: VramScope Profiling Issues

If a customer says VramScope crashes their training job or reports bogus GPU memory numbers, first check which driver shim they're on — the older shim double-counts pooled allocations, which looks scary but is harmless. Real red flags: profiler overhead above 15% or OOMs that only happen with profiling enabled. Grab the trace bundle and session log before escalating; the tooling team can't do much without them. Send bundles and a short summary to the profiling on-call.

billing contact of yawip-yadup = druath.casdor@nelvrolabs.internal

Quarterly Planning Note — Legacy Price Increase

Heads of department: effective next quarter, legacy Bramford Suite customers move to updated pricing. Increase: 12% average, capped at 18% for the oldest contracts. Grandfathering ends for accounts signed before the Tollvale migration. Comms go out in stage two; support scripts are drafted. Expect churn of 3–5%; retention offers are pre-approved for strategic accounts only. Route escalations through revenue ops. The confidential framing on wider business plans follows below.

internal memo for hahaf-kahof: Only 39 of the 428 pilot accounts renewed Sorion, so a churn review is set for April 12. Praokix Freight is in early talks to buy Queniusox Group for about $145.8 million.